BTW, one solution, I implemented for a buddy -- he wants to be RFC
compliant, and not just "ignore" postmaster email... thus,
postmaster at his-domain gets responded to with this message, using vacation:
_ _ _ _ _ _ _
From: The Postmaster <postmaster at basementshow.net>
Subject: Pointer to postmaster at basementshow.net
Please contact the Basement Internet Show postmaster at the following
(munged) address:
webmaster -at- basementshow.net
This message is an autoresponse, placed here in order to quell massive
amounts of spam. We apologize for the inconvenience.
-The Basement Show Management
_ _ _ _ _ _ _
...this requires a new username, vacation, and an alieas for
"webmaster at domain".
